Crossgar's Conor Swail produced the second Irish win of the weekend at the three-star Northern Ireland International Horse Show on Saturday, beating Britain's John Whitaker in the big
jump-off class, the Irish Horse Board International Competition.

Piloting the eight year-old Glen Leddy-owned chestnut stallion Gold Digger, the Co Down rider went head-to-head with the British veteran in a two-horse jump-off, but Whitaker was unable to match Swail's time of 33.74.

Earlier, Shane Breen was best of the Irish with Carmena Z in the Top Score competition, which was won by Australia's Matt Williams
and where Conor Swail also took a sixth place.

Billy Twomey notched up Ireland's first win at Belfast with
Pikap in the Winning Round competition on Thursday night.
